Speaker: Dr. Ritoban Basu Thakur (NASA Jet Propulsion Laboratory / Caltech)
 
Title: Observational Cosmology with Superconducting Sensors
 
Abstract: Observational Cosmology aims at understanding the rich history of our universe, peering through billions of light-years of cosmic evolution. To capture the faint signals from high redshifts we develop and deploy astronomical instruments with superconducting sensors -- a variety of them geared toward specific science cases. These sensors also become useful in radiostronomy for studying astrophysical objects that are not necessarily at cosmological distances. This talk will review a class of superconducting sensors being developed at Caltech and NASA-JPL for studying the Cosmic Microwave Background and structure formation in the early universe.
